Legal Action Against Badshah
An FIR has been registered against popular Indian rapper Badshah for his song ‘Tateeree’, which has drawn significant criticism for its portrayal of schoolgirls. The FIR, filed on March 6, 2026, cites violations under Section 296 of the Bharatiya Nyaya Sanhita and Sections 3 and 4 of the Indecent Representation of Women (Prohibition) Act, 1986.
The song allegedly depicts minor girls in school uniforms throwing their school bags and running away from studies, a portrayal that has been condemned by various officials. The Haryana Education Minister, Mahipal Dhanda, remarked, “The depiction of school girls in the song and the manner our culture is shown in it is condemnable.”
In response to the backlash, Badshah issued a public apology, stating, “I belong to Haryana, and I had no intention to speak indecently about any woman or children. If anyone is hurt, I seek apology. I expect that you will forgive me by considering me the son of Haryana.”
As part of the investigation, the Haryana Police have initiated the process of issuing a Look Out Circular (LOC) against Badshah to prevent him from leaving the country. Continuous police raids are being conducted to locate and arrest him, with warnings issued against anyone spreading objectionable content related to the song.
Additionally, the Haryana State Commission for Women has summoned Badshah to appear on March 13. Investigators are also looking into whether proper permission was obtained for using a Haryana Roadways bus in the music video.
The song has already been removed from YouTube, and notices have been sent to take it down from other social media platforms. Two FIRs have been triggered by the song’s content, one naming Badshah and another against unidentified persons.
Rahul Jain, a representative of Haryana Roadways, stated, “We did not provide any bus for the shooting of the song.” This raises further questions about the production and permissions related to the music video.
As the situation unfolds, Badshah is expected to appear before the police as per the formal notice issued. Investigators will also question crew members involved in the music video to gather more information.
